Bridge Collapse in Eastern China Kills Two, Leaves Three Missing
(MENAFN) A tragic construction accident in Yancheng city, eastern China’s Jiangsu province, has left two people dead and three others missing. The incident occurred on Monday when a section of a bridge still under construction suddenly gave way.
Emergency teams were dispatched immediately, and search-and-rescue operations continued overnight to locate the missing workers. Authorities have confirmed that an investigation is underway to determine the cause of the collapse, though details remain limited.
Local officials have urged caution around construction sites and emphasized the importance of safety inspections as the inquiry proceeds. The incident has raised concerns about construction safety practices in the region, highlighting the risks associated with large infrastructure projects.
